If you want to nail the process server, you'll have to first find out what state law requires for him to function as a process server. Then find out who you complain to. It would also help if you get a list of the lying process server's 'victims' and contact them as well. A record of misdeeds adds weight to your complaint. You should be able to find a 'trail' on the guy thru the court public records of lawsuits. Takes some legwork, but they ARE required to keep records.
